Jamie Lea Braithwaite hosting "JOYrific Podcast Season 3" features a weekly lineup of engaging and educational segments. Each Monday, listeners can tune in for the "Monday Mental Health Minute" cohosted by Dr. Matt Larsen, where mental health topics are discussed in a concise and accessible manner. Tuesdays are reserved for "Taco 'bout Technology with Garth," a playful and informative session that dives into the latest technological trends and innovations, often accompanied by some taco-about anything parenting adventures. JOYrific Podcast 2013: Customizing the Chart for Your Family 22.01.2014

Jamie Braithwaite and Shauna Earl discuss the magnet chart, practicing with the children, moving the magnets around and continued to adapt the JOYrific chart after the initial novelty wore off. Only you can move your magnet. The magic happened when the children could talk about the four reasons that was causing their frustrations and then they could figure out how to fix it.

JOYrific Podcast 2013: Communication 01.01.2014

The topic of communication. How does the JOYrific Chart help you communicate? The JOYrific chart is a form of communication that puts us all on the same plain. It is important that we get the same vocabulary going to create understanding. Explaining a complex topic in a simplistic way. We have an amount of energy to communicate some for understanding and some for action.
